Transaction 4943a95531f760bf4598e9fd88e9e971928c31f520d490c52534f93f716d17ee

1 Input
2 Outputs
  • 4943a95531f760bf4598e9fd88e9e971928c31f520d490c52534f93f716d17ee:0
  • value  1175505
    address  3PgBxu8LMAZhoL3Up7wFrpt8k3viSXvB3J
  • 4943a95531f760bf4598e9fd88e9e971928c31f520d490c52534f93f716d17ee:1
  • value  17277264
    address  38ehqKvYJbs5yxSNfqPiiX8oSA6P1B65Zv